Federal Jobs Can Get You Loan Forgiveness

You may be capable to handle the Public Service Loan Forgiveness Program, which becomes the government's method of bringing in more employees into public service. What the federal government is now pushing is that college graduates who qualified for the federal student loan might have the opportunity to have their loans forgiven whenever they work hold federal jobs.

After around one hundred twenty payments were made by a full-time federal employee while under employment to public service employers, they could get loan forgiveness . However, only those previous students who have been paying since October 2007 can qualify for loan forgiveness. Therefore, the very first loan forgiveness cancellations will only be made by October 2017.

The College Cost Reduction and Access Act of 2007 allows for this forgiveness if ever the student would be qualified for their Federal Direct Loan. The agency doesn't take any periods of forbearance or deferment into consideration, neither are payments made before that period.

Any federal employee can qualify - those working with public education or health institutions, with social ...
... work, with the military, fire, or police department, and with federal or local government except for an elected member of Congress.

Any students who qualified for Federal Direct Consolidation Loans, Federal Direct Stafford Loans, or Federal Direct PLUS Loans are eligible for that forgiveness program. Any borrower who took out a student loan under the FFEL or Federal Family Education Loan Program, Perkins Loans, Grad PLUS, or Parent PLUS ought to have to consolidate their loans into direct ones.

However, those who qualified for the Perkins Loan may perhaps have to think twice. There are excellent benefits with Perkins, from a 9-month grace period to an inclusive loan forgiveness program.

Repayment during the first ten years is relatively simple, passing through a standard repayment, income-based repayment, income contingent repayment, or a mixture of any of these. A new employee's most suitable option may not be the standard repayment scheme as it wouldn't make the most of this forgiveness program. One of the best parts of the loan? It's not subject to any taxes at all.
